I am troubled by a recent series of posts I came across on a Jaguar site. A regular contributor and true enthusiast with an S-type R (supercharged V8 in midsized performance sedan) seems to have felt the need to demonstrate his Jaguar was faster than a Subaru WRX on a city street. It is an old story but the lessons are still valid.
The problem is both these cars (and SRT 6's) are seriously fast. I am not sure who was winning when the Jaguar, flipping end over end, ran head on into the lady in the Hyundai but we can be sure its driver and the lady were the losers.
As a car guy (and an old one) I have owned many performance cars, none more fun than my Myer's Manx type dune buggy and Fiat 850 Spyder (both of which I would drive flat out right up to their 60-70 mph top speeds) nor as fast as my modified SRT 6.
Things can get serious quickly with these cars. It is not always about ones own driving abilities. The unexpected can happen quicker than reaction times and laws of physics permit corrections for.
Be careful out there. The roads are shared.
